Transaction 2425a24361eb9d61a277ba26c157a346e898a6d8396aae31ce2244093cf4f757
1 Input
1 Output
-
2425a24361eb9d61a277ba26c157a346e898a6d8396aae31ce2244093cf4f757:0
- value
- 3220467
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4aa2a539b88e130fee3a0d178e04401513433ecb OP_EQUALVERIFY OP_CHECKSIG
- address
- 17odqzpDKwQdwA6Q3EpuimPoJDq89UNYjZ